Learning Center East (Closed 2015)

941 76th St
Newaygo, MI 49337
(School attendance zone shown in map)
Learning Center East serves 25 students in grades 9-12. 
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math was ≤20% (which was lower than the Michigan state average of 37%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ts was ≤20% (which was lower than the Michigan state average of 64%).
The student:teacher ratio of 25:1 was higher than the Michigan state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ment was 4%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which was lower than the Michigan state average of 37% (majority Black).
